| We decided to make a footclutch pedal in stainless steel to
match the brakepedal, so we started out with a thick strip of
stainless and machined it to be tapered both in the height and
width, after that it was a lot of sanding and polishing to get
a tapered oval shape |

| After experimenting with some wire to get the right shape we
deided that the footrest also did not have the right shape yet,
so we applied some heat and did some reshaping. We machined some
teeth for the toerest, then welded all the bits together. |



| Well, the rest was just a lot of hours
of welding, filing, grinding, sanding and polishing as usual |
